Brentford kept their hands on top spot in League Two thanks to early goals from Jordan Rhodes and Charlie MacDonald at Rochdale. Thomas Kennedy pulled one back for Dale after Ryan Dickson was penalised for handball eight minutes before the break, but the Bees held on. This was Brentford's third win in four games, and they are now three points clear of Wycombe and Bury. The visitors took the lead in the ninth minute when Rhodes headed home Sam Wood's cross. And MacDonald doubled his side's lead, which proved to be unassailable, on the quarter-hour mark when he fired into the bottom right-hand corner of Frank Fielding's goal after picking up Wood's pass inside the box. Rochdale could have moved to within a point of the automatic promotion places had they won the game, and they gave themselves some hope with Kennedy's conversion from the spot before the break. And they had the lion's share of the play in the second half as they piled on the pressure in search of a valuable equaliser. Will Buckley, Chris Dagnall, Nathan Stanton and Lee McEvilly all had good chances to prevent what became Rochdale's first home league defeat since October, 4. Despite the loss, Rochdale are still firmly ensconced in the play-off picture.
